A. Meldrum et al., EFFECTS OF IONIZING AND DISPLACIVE IRRADIATION ON SEVERAL PEROVSKITE-STRUCTURE OXIDES, Nuclear instruments & methods in physics research. Section B, Beam interactions with materials and atoms, 141(1-4), 1998, pp. 347-352
Synthetic single crystals of CaTiO3, SrTiO3, BaTiO3, KNbO3, and KTaO3
were irradiated by 800 keV Kr+ ions over a range of temperature from 2
0 to 900 K. The dose required for amorphization was monitored by selec
ted-area electron diffraction. All of the compounds were found to beco
me amorphous over the temperature range investigated, although a signi
ficant variation was observed in the critical amorphization temperatur
e, i.e., the temperature above which amorphization was not induced. Th
is variation is related to chemical differences through a combination
of factors, including bonding variations and the ratio of electronic-t
o-nuclear energy loss. Some of the perovskite-structure compounds unde
rgo one or more instantaneous displacive phase transitions; however, t
hese structural changes were not found to significantly affect the amo
rphization dose in these experiments. (C) 1998 Published by Elsevier S
